Latest Patents:
White's latest patents showcase his expertise in creating innovative refrigerant charging systems. One of his notable inventions is the "Refrigerant charging system controlled by charging pressure change rate", which introduces a novel method for precisely controlling the charging of refrigerant into a refrigeration system. This system not only determines the mass amount of refrigerant charged but also incorporates features such as pressure compensated flow valves and the ability to select from a variety of refrigerant types.
